Job Description

Purpose of the role

To build and maintain infrastructure platforms and products that support applications and data systems, using hardware, software, networks, and cloud computing platforms as required with the aim of ensuring that the infrastructure is reliable, scalable, and secure.  Ensure the reliability, availability, and scalability of the systems, platforms, and technology through the application of software engineering techniques, automation, and best practices in incident response. 

Accountabilities

  • Build Engineering:  Development, delivery, and maintenance of high-quality infrastructure solutions to fulfil business requirements ensuring measurable reliability, performance, availability, and ease of use. Including the identification of the appropriate technologies and solutions to meet business, optimisation, and resourcing requirements.
  • Incident Management: Monitoring of IT infrastructure and system performance to measure, identify, address, and resolve any potential issues, vulnerabilities, or outages. Use of data to drive down mean time to resolution.
  • Automation:  Development and implementation of automated tasks and processes to improve efficiency and reduce manual intervention, utilising software scripting/coding disciplines.
  • Security: Implementation of a secure configuration and measures to protect infrastructure against cyber-attacks, vulnerabilities, and other security threats, including protection of hardware, software, and data from unauthorised access.
  • Teamwork:  Cross-functional collaboration with product managers, architects, and other engineers to define IT Infrastructure requirements, devise solutions, and ensure seamless integration and alignment with business objectives via a data driven approach.
  • Learning: Stay informed of industry technology trends and innovations, and actively contribute to the organization's technology communities to foster a culture of technical excellence and growth.

To be successful as a Risk Manager VP Global Network Services, you should have experience with (Mandatory Skillsets required):

The role is responsible to globally manage risk & control for Networks.  This role holds global accountabilities for all regions.

  • Lead the risk & compliance position for Network platform team within Global technology infrastructure tower.
  • Detailed knowledge of the major components in Network technology space.
  • Competent in discussing technologies and products with vendors/auditors.
  • Proven experience in risk and control management for infrastructure technology areas, preferably in a regulated financial services environment.
  • Drive the remediation of vulnerabilities in Network products. Ensure all vulnerabilities are treated within the SLA per the vulnerability management standard.
  • Ensure that controls for cryptography are in place for all cryptographic assets in Network estate including inventory, algorithms, key length and key rotation. Key compromise plan and life cycle management are documented for the services in scope.
  • New products in Network are assessed for technology & cyber control effectiveness like security configuration, backups, resilience, vulnerability & configuration management.
  • Interface with technology teams to build a robust security framework for Network technology.
  • Review, drive & implement the industry security best practices for Network technologies. 
  • Drives the definition of the Network Services: controls, risk appetite and mitigation, reporting and metrics for external and internal audit, attestations etc.
  • Interfaces and influences stakeholders of Networks Platforms, including internal and external auditors, Central risk functions and business units to deliver control requirements and agree roadmaps
  • Works closely with and represents the Network Product to teams including Engineering, Architecture, Group Risk, Group Security, and BCM. Ensure planned changes to sister IS services and architectures are in line with the Network risk and compliance roadmap, and vice versa
  • Guide and matrix-manage multiple Barclay’s teams to deliver the Network risk and compliance agenda
  • Document waiver & breaches for risk gaps in technology & cyber controls & track the remediation of the breach actions as per the SLA agreed with CCO(Chief Control Office) team.
